首页 > 软件资讯 > PHP字符串拼接SQL语句技巧

PHP字符串拼接SQL语句技巧

时间:2026-02-11 09:11:34

在PHP中,可通过自定义函数连接字符串以生成SQL语句,下文将举例说明具体实现方法。

- 创建一个名为test.php的文件,演示PHP中如何拼接字符串以构建SQL语句。

在test.php文件中定义一个名为getSql的函数,该函数用于生成SQL查询语句。函数包含三个参数:第一个参数$table表示目标数据表名称,第二个参数$wheres用于指定查询条件,第三个参数$fields指定需要查询的字段列表,通过组合这三个参数动态构建并返回相应的SQL语句。

在test.php文件中,通过使用`$fields`和`$table`这两个变量,结合`SELECT`语句生成并执行一个专门针对特定数据表的SQL查询请求。

在test.php文件中,通过if语句检查$wheres变量是否为空;若不为空,则将其与前一步生成的SQL语句进行连接,构成针对特定条件的完整查询语句,并最终将其返回以供后续数据检索使用。

在test.php文件中调用getSql函数生成并输出指定条件下的SQL语句示例。例如,生成选择user表中的name字段,且ID值为记录。

- 用浏览器打开test.php文件,观察运行结果。

定义一个名为getSql的函数,该函数接受三个参数:$table表示目标数据表,$wheres表示查询条件,$fields指定需要查询的字段。

在函数中使用select时,只需结合变量$fields和$data_table拼接生成指定数据表的查询语句。

9、 在函数内部,利用if语句判断查询条件$wheres是否为空;若不为空,则将其与前一步生成的SQL语句进行拼接,构建成针对特定条件的完整查询语句,最终通过return语句将拼接完成的SQL语句返回。

- 调用getSql函数生成SQL语句,并通过echo命令输出结果。

热门推荐